签收状态查询

  • 接口:/signForTasks

  • Method:POST

  • 数据格式:JSON

  • 请求参数:

字段 类型 必须 默认值 描述
employeeIds String数组 N 员工工号数组
formCodes String数组 N 单据号数组
category String N 签收状态,可选择值为NEED_SIGN(待签收),SIGNED(已签收)
start String N 根据单据到达待签收人的时间, 返回之后的数据(包含当天)
end String N 根据单据到达待签收人的时间,返回之前的数据 (不包含当天)
offset int N 0 分页起始
limit int N 500 分页条数

#

  • start, end的格式为yyyy-MM-dd
  • 接口最多返回500条记录;可通过offset, limit进行分页
  • 结果集按照签收任务创建时间升序排列

返回数据:

字段 类型 描述
formCode String 单据号
employeeId String 员工工号
category String 签收状态,值为NEED_SIGN(待签收),SIGNED(已签收)
formType String 单据类型,值为REIMBURSE(普通报销)CORP_REIMBURSE(对公报销)

示例

  • 请求示例:
{
    "employeeIds":["10001"],
    "formCodes":[],
    "category":"NEED_SIGN",
    "start":"2018-04-10",
    "end":"2018-05-22",
    "offset":0,
    "limit":500
}
  • 返回示例:
{
  "code": "ACK",
  "message": null,
  "data": [
    {
      "formCode": "MY117081203",
      "employeeId": "10001",
      "category": "NEED_SIGN"
    },
    {
      "formCode": "MY117081204",
      "employeeId": "10001",
      "category": "NEED_SIGN"
    }
  ],
  "args": null,
  "linkDetail": false,
  "lastPage": true,
  "nonBizError": false
}

results matching ""

    No results matching ""